The Social Presence of Girls and Women in the Prophet and Imams era:

According to Islamic historical and religious sources, Umm al-Mu'minin Khadijah Kobri "S" was a business woman and did business.[1] Hazrat Zahra "S" taught women Sharia rulings and resolved girls and women's religious disputes. His presence in the mosque and his speech in defense of the position of “Willayah” and “Imamate” are other documents that not only do not prohibit the presence of girls and women in society, but sometimes consider it obligatory.[2]

Hazrat Ali (pbuh) allowed his scholar daughter Zainab Kobri (pbuh) to educate the Muslim women of Kufa and solve their scientific and religious problems. Hazrat Zainab organized a session on Qur'an interpretation for them and answered their questions and doubts. That is why Imam Sajjad (a.s) called her “The Scholar with out being taught”[3]

Imam Sadiq (a.s.) said: When the Messenger of God conquered Mecca, the men  pledged allegiance to the Noble Prophet (s.a), then the women came to pledge allegiance to him, [4] and God revealed the 12th verse of Surah Mumtahnah. This verse is one of the most important examples of the effective emergence of girls and women in the society at the highest level.[5]

Conclusion:

Islam does not consider women as a worthless creature to have a gender attitude towards her, nor does it have a liberal view of her. Rather, there is a third way to play the role of a woman, and that is for a woman to become a precious person, to be both a person and precious. On the one hand, she should have a spiritual personality and on the other hand, she should not be vulgar in society. In the light of this character and preciousness, chastity is established in the society. The institution of the family and the spirit of the family remain in the society.
